Arsenal`s top striker returns as one of the faces for the Pro Evo series
Last month it was announced that Chelseaâs John Terry was one of the faces of Pro Evolution Soccer 5, and today itâs been confirmed that heâll be joined by Thierry Henry of Arsenal. The two time Premiership Golden Boot winner, Henry is set to make his second consecutive appearance as one of the PES face, and will feature on the front of the game packages throughout Europe.
Making the announcement, Martin Schneider, European Marketing & PR Director for Konami of Europe said, âWe have a vision of football and how it should be interpreted as a video gameâ¦This vision extends from the talented development team through to everyone involved with Pro Evolution Soccer 5 â“ and we are delighted that a player of Thierry Henryâs calibre [sic] buys into our ideas and enthusiasm, and are extremely pleased to have him on board for a second year. Henry shares our ideas of how we can make Pro Evolution Soccer 5 an entertaining and engrossing simulation of the most popular sport in Europe, and we look forward to working closely with this football legend.â
âI have been playing Pro Evolution Soccer games for over ten years now,â commented Henry himself. âIt was great to be the face of such a realistic and engrossing football title, so I was delighted to return for the newest version. I look forward to being closely involved with the creation and promotion of what promises to be a stunning game.â
In addition to the announcement, the press release also suggests one other piece of interesting information â“ that Konami may have struck a deal with Arsenal Football Club to license the clubâs trademarks for Pro Evolution Soccer 5. The disclaimer at the bottom of the statement says:
âThe Arsenal crest, Arsenal logotype and cannon are trademarks of Arsenal Football Club Plc and the Arsenal group of companies and are used under license. TM & © 2005 The Arsenal Football Club plc. Licensed by Granada Venturesâ
No confirmation of this has been made at the moment, itâs certainly one piece of information that weâll be keeping an eye out for in the future.
